Location


A stay at Palacio Salvetti Suites places you in the heart of Alicante, within a 10-minute walk of Alicante Harbour and Postiguet Beach. This aparthotel is 0.5 mi (0.8 km) from El Corte Ingles Shopping Center and 5.1 mi (8.3 km) from San Juan Beach.

Facilities


Take advantage of recreation opportunities such as bicycles to rent or take in the view from a terrace and a garden. Additional features at this aparthotel include complimentary wireless internet access and tour/ticket assistance.

Business Facilities


Featured amenities include express check-in, express check-out, and luggage storage. Guests may use a roundtrip airport shuttle for a surcharge, and self parking (subject to charges) is available onsite.

Dining


Take advantage of the aparthotel's room service. Continental breakfasts are available daily from 10:00 AM to 11 AM for a fee.

Rooms


Make yourself at home in one of the 10 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ring kitchens with refrigerators and ovens.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and flat-screen televisions are provided for your entertainment. Conveniences include safes and separate sitting areas, and housekeeping is provided weekly.

This is small hotel with full kitchen. The building is of heritage importance with tasteful contemporary updates creating a quite magnificent product. The room we stayed in was very comfortable with a large luxurious bathroom. Due to the small nature of the hotel, check-in, hotel access are a bit different from a normal hotel, however was efficient and easy. This hotel does not have restaurants but has a lot of selection within a few seconds to a few minutes walk, along with supermarkets close by. The location is very central and close to lots of amenities within walking distance.

First off, the place is an old ~4 story building on the edge of a pedestrian zone. You will be greeted with a grand door, and a beautiful marble interior and marble stair case. Walking in was amazing, giving the impression you had picked a truly amazing place. Amazing details in the shared areas. Art, glass floor, atrium, etc. It was the service which really let us down. There were two events, I’ll let you judge: 1) Prior to our arrival, we started getting phone calls. They were concerned about whether we were aware that it the bonfire festival was on, and the streets would be closed. Nice service right? But what got strange was how much they called. Are you still coming? Have you decided? Will you be cancelling your stay? It started to feel like they did not want us to come. That they realized that if we cancelled, with the festival, they could get 2x the rate 2) After the long drive, we wanted a shower to freshen up before we explored the city. There was no hot water. We mentioned this on the way out, and went about our day. The next day, on the way out we mentioned it to an older gentleman who materialized, who started to tell us that was impossible, because it was electric heat. He started to come across patronizing and would not listen or help. I raised this with Hotels.com, for whom they lied that there was water. I raised this directly with the company, who seemed to get emotional, offered nothing of value. Very poor customer service. Cheap.
